About AI Training Work

AI systems learn from examples prepared, reviewed, and rated by people. In this role, your patient access knowledge will help evaluate AI-generated workflow outputs, document observations, and create structured feedback that supports more accurate healthcare operations.

Human reviewers play an important role in improving AI tools. Their feedback helps models handle specialized processes, terminology, policies, and operational requirements more reliably.
